GRAND FORKS, N.D. - Wet weather has slowed the sugar beet harvest in parts of North Dakota.

Jerry Christenson with American Crystal Sugar said harvesting is at a standstill south of Highway 2, but conditions are better north of there.

He said the harvest normally takes about three weeks, but could last up to a month this year.

Christenson said rain delays during the harvest aren't that unusual.
